-
大小: 2.16MB文件類型: .rar金幣: 2下載: 0 次發布日期: 2023-11-15
- 語言: 其他
- 標簽: pic??pic16f??pic16f1937??
資源簡介
PIC16F1937的實例程序,簡單易懂,適合初學者,實例全部測試通過。

代碼片段和文件信息
/**************************************************************************************************************************
*@file ledblink.c
*@author JPDQ
*@version v01
*@date 06-01-2019?0x53c9
*@功能說明 點亮接在RD1端口的LED1燈,通過延時程序實現1s閃爍
*@接線方法??使用杜邦線或短路帽連接開發板上的相關插針
RD1接LED1
*@接線注意事項??為了保證使用品質,保護單片機引腳不被人體靜電損壞,優先推薦使用杜邦線來連接
*@需要短路帽連接的時候,應盡量避免手指直接觸碰連接到芯片引腳的插針,同時,插拔短路帽的時候板子最好不要帶電插拔,斷電后再插拔。
*****************************************************************************************************************************/
#include?“pic.h“
__CONFIG(FOSC_HS&WDTE_OFF); //配置字一,選擇外部振蕩器,關閉看門狗
__CONFIG(BOREN_OFF&LVP_OFF&PLLEN_OFF); //配置字二,關閉低電壓復位,關閉低電壓編程,關閉時鐘4倍頻
//不同編譯器版本的配置字寫法可能不同,此為采用PICC?9.83版本的編譯器配置字
#define?uint?unsigned?int
#define?uchar?unsigned?char
/*
*@brief ms延時程序,16Mhz條件下ms延時程序
*@prama None
*@retval Value
*/
void?delayms(uint?m)
{
??? uint?ab;
????for(b=m;b>0;b--)
????{
???? for(a=443;a>0;a--);
????}
}
void?main(void)
{
ANSD1=0; //RD1配置為數字IO,上電后默認是模擬IO
TRISD1=0; //RD1設為輸出
while(1)
{
LATD1^=1; //RD1輸出電平取反,實現LED燈閃爍
delayms(1000);
}
}
?屬性????????????大小?????日期????時間???名稱
-----------?---------??----------?-----??----
?????文件?????????60??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件??????13955??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件???????1368??2019-05-17?14:59??PIC16F1937例程\01&LEDbl
?????文件???????6911??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件????????352??2019-04-06?21:48??PIC16F1937例程\01&LEDbl
?????文件????????309??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件????????821??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件??????18706??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件??????18893??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件???????1045??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件???????7115??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件?????930304??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件????????952??2019-04-06?21:48??PIC16F1937例程\01&LEDbl
?????文件???????1958??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件?????249236??2019-05-17?14:59??PIC16F1937例程\01&LEDbl
?????文件??????69246??2019-05-17?14:59??PIC16F1937例程\01&LEDbl
?????文件??????21230??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件??????70821??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件???????4645??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件?????????47??2019-04-06?21:48??PIC16F1937例程\01&LEDbl
?????文件???????4098??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件???????5212??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件???????3949??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件???????5750??2019-05-17?15:00??PIC16F1937例程\01&LEDbl
?????文件?????????89??2019-05-17?19:57??PIC16F1937例程\02&KEY\funclist
?????文件??????20046??2019-05-17?19:57??PIC16F1937例程\02&KEY\key.as
?????文件???????2597??2019-05-17?14:55??PIC16F1937例程\02&KEY\key.c
?????文件???????9493??2019-05-17?19:57??PIC16F1937例程\02&KEY\key.cof
?????文件????????698??2019-05-17?19:57??PIC16F1937例程\02&KEY\key.hex
?????文件????????963??2019-05-17?19:57??PIC16F1937例程\02&KEY\key.hxl
............此處省略481個文件信息
- 上一篇:LOIC-master.zip
- 下一篇:FFT快速傅立葉變換)圖文并茂
評論
共有 條評論